Description

In the intricate world of Windows 2000, the Registry serves as the backbone for system configuration, providing a crucial framework for managing various components. This guide delves into the complexities of the Windows 2000 Registry, equipping system administrators with essential knowledge and practical techniques to navigate and manipulate this vital resource effectively.

Paul Robichaux draws on his extensive expertise to offer insights that demystify the often intimidating landscape of the Registry. He illuminates the importance of each key and value, empowering readers to understand their interconnections and the role they play in system performance and stability. Through a practical lens, he illustrates common scenarios where registry tweaks can lead to improved functionality and optimal system behavior.

Moreover, the book provides users with troubleshooting strategies, enabling them to identify and resolve widely encountered problems. From enhancing security settings to optimizing software interactions, the reader learns how to tailor the Windows 2000 environment to specific needs while maintaining system integrity.

As a comprehensive resource, it is an indispensable tool for both novice and seasoned system administrators, fostering confidence in managing their Windows 2000 systems. By mastering the intricacies of the Registry, they can ensure a smoother, more efficient operational landscape.
